313 bounces html (i.e. multi-part MIME) messages, so you're not
getting them from hyperreal.org.

You're getting a reply from someone who hits "REPLY ALL"  it will look
as though it came from 313, but in fact, it came directly from the
sender, in all it's mult-ipart MIME glory, and the message won't ever
make it to the 313 subscribers.
